Surely no player has ever been knocked out so quickly in rugby.


Argentina kicked off at Emirates Airlines Park and their start went deep into the 22 to where Williams was poised to gather. He caught the ball on the five-metre line, but his right-footed kick was blocked on 10 seconds by the charging Juan Cruz Mallia.

If you change the YT video settings playback speed to as low as it can go, he jumps in the air to charge down the kick. He jumped before Williams kicked, so he was already committed.

He did contest the ball as it bounced off his feet when he was in the air. If he completely missed the ball, it would be easier to say it was reckless play. 

Williams was not catching the high ball, so he had not won the contest for the space in the air. He was standing in a stationary position. 

I just looks like an unintentional consequence of such a physical sport.
His left hip hit Williams in the head, as he turned in the air. 

I think the videos can be reviewed to see if their is any intent to hit Williams, but if it appears like an accident he will not be punished.
